Indicator-of-Compromise feed
Public, machine-readable feed of indicators AEGIS surfaces from the Protection Network. Returned as a STIX 2.1 Bundle so it slots into existing threat-intel pipelines.
GET https://api.mnemom.ai/v1/trust/iocsNo authentication required. Rate-limited at the gateway plus a best-effort in-handler check (1 req/min/IP). Pagination via ?after=<ISO-8601 timestamp> on the previous response's next_after field.
Calm-at-GA contract
At GA the feed may be empty. That's the system telling the truth: when AEGIS has no closed campaigns and no live indicators, the feed surfaces an empty STIX bundle rather than theatre.

Indicator extensions
Indicators with canonical STIX patterns (sha256 hashes, domains, URLs) emit those patterns directly. Mnemom-internal indicator classes (substrate fingerprints, MITRE ATT&CK technique IDs) carry the value inside a Mnemom property-extension on the STIX indicator SDO. The extension also carries the Traffic Light Protocol class, a synthetic-fixture marker, and the related advisory id when present.
